As a police officer in Canada , I have been talking about something like this for years. I have always stated I wish I had a video camera following me around so that judges and the public could see the things we do and see the scene instead of just description of it.

I welcome this change with open arms. If I make a mistake while wearing one I welcome it being recorded I have nothing to hide. I will do the best I can, like I always have but I'm human.
